What Are Pokémon Pixel Art Templates?
Pixel art is a digital art form that uses small pixels to create detailed graphics—think classic video games from the 80s and 90s. For Pokémon enthusiasts, pixel art brings the beloved franchise to life in a small, scalable, and visually charming format. Pixel art templates provide pre-designed outlines and color grids, making it easier than ever to customize and create detailed Pokémon illustrations without starting from a blank canvas.
These free downloadable templates are typically optimized for programs like Photoshop, Aseprite, or Correction, so you can import, modify, and export your work with ease. They come in various styles—from retro 8-bit shapes to upgraded modern interpretations—giving you flexibility whether you want a vintage look or a fresh twist.

Why Download Free Pokémon Pixel Art Templates?
-
Start Fast & Create Creative Projects
With pre-made structure, you skip the initial setup time and dive straight into adding your own personality. Perfect for content creators, educators, or fan artists. -
Learn Pixeling Techniques
Following existing pixel grids teaches spacing, shading, and color blending—valuable skills for both retro and modern pixel art. -
Affordable & Accessible Art Creation
Free templates remove financial barriers, enabling anyone passionate about Pokémon and art to create stunning visuals. -
Share & Inspire the Community
Upload your creations to fan forums, art platforms, or social media to connect with others who share your love for Pokémon.

How to Start Creating Your First Pixel Art Today
-
Download Your Template
Choose a layout matching your desired Pokémon style—simple, detailed, or dynamic pose. -
Set Up Your Workspace
Open tools like Aseprite or Photoshop, import the template, and toggle layers for outlines and colors. -
Work Pixel by Pixel
Follow the grid carefully. Use soft brushes for shading and bright palettes inspired by classic Pokémon.
